가자공부하러!

isContains(문자열 정수인지, 포함되는지 판별) 본문

공부/내 라이브러리

isContains(문자열 정수인지, 포함되는지 판별)

오피스엑소더스 2019. 5. 20. 22:24
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
public class IsContains {
    boolean isContainNumber(String strIn, int min, int max) {
        // 입력받은 문자열 strIn이 정수인지 판별하고
        // 정수인 경우 min값 이상 max값 이하이면 true 리턴
        boolean isThat = true;
        try {
            int num = Integer.parseInt(strIn);
            if (num < min || num > max) {
                isThat = false;
            } else {
                isThat = true;
            }
 
        } catch (NumberFormatException e) {
            isThat = false;
        }
 
        return isThat;
    }// 메서드 중괄호
}
cs


1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
boolean isContainYOrN(String strIn) {
    // 입력받은 문자열 strIn의 첫 글자가 Y 또는 N인지 확인
    boolean isThat = true;
    try {
      char chInYOrN = strIn.toUpperCase().charAt(0);
      if (chInYOrN == 'Y'  || chInYOrN == 'N') {
        isThat = false;
        } else {
            isThat = true;
        }
    } catch (NumberFormatException e) {
        isThat = false;
    }
    return isThat;
}// 메서드 중괄호
cs























'공부 > 내 라이브러리' 카테고리의 다른 글

패키지 구조를 트리 형식으로 출력하기(windows), Octotree  (0) 2019.09.19
유용한 기능 모음(JSP)  (0) 2019.06.27
개발환경  (0) 2019.06.18
셔플 알고리즘( java )  (0) 2019.05.21
Comments